Rear Axle Identification...

I've got an 87 Ford F-250 with a 6.9 Diesel and am looking for some help on how to identify what rear end it has in it. First off i am looking for a dana 60 to put in my offroad truck project and it looks to be about like a dana 60 in it, although it isn't a full-floater. Does anyone have any clues that can help me identify what it may have? Thanks, Matt

It's got a diesel and it's not a full floating axle? Somebody swapped the axle out at one point too, then.

Look at the rear cover - does it have a fill plug about halfway up the cover? If so, it's a Dana axle of some type. If not, it's most likely a sterling 10.25". I think D60's were the only 8-lug axles that came as a semi-floater, but I'm not 100% sure. If you can find a Dana bill of materials number on the axle, I have a decoder for it. It's usually seven digits long with a dash before the last digit.
